Management Commentary

During the earnings call, CMC’s leadership focused heavily on prevailing market conditions for steel and related construction materials, as well as internal operational progress over the course of the quarter. Management noted that demand for the company’s core steel products was supported by steady activity in the non-residential construction and infrastructure segments, which have remained resilient amid broader macroeconomic fluctuations. They also highlighted that recently implemented operational efficiency programs across Commercial’s production and distribution network helped offset residual volatility in energy and logistics costs, supporting margin stability that contributed to the reported EPS figure. Leadership also emphasized the company’s growing focus on low-carbon recycled steel production, noting that customer demand for sustainable construction materials has continued to rise in recent months, creating new potential revenue streams for the firm. No additional specific operational metrics were provided outside of the confirmed EPS figure, per available public call records. Forward Guidance

CMC’s leadership provided qualitative forward guidance during the call, avoiding specific numerical targets to align with their standard disclosure practices. Management noted that while core end-market demand trends remain broadly positive for the near term, there are several potential risks that could impact future performance, including fluctuations in global raw material pricing, shifts in public infrastructure spending timelines, and broader macroeconomic uncertainty that could lead to softer demand from residential construction customers. They added that the company plans to continue investing in expanding its recycled steel production capacity, with scheduled facility upgrades set to roll out across multiple locations in upcoming months. Leadership also noted that they will maintain flexible inventory and production policies to adjust quickly to shifting market conditions, to minimize the risk of margin compression from oversupply or sudden drops in demand.
